OEIS defines the notion of Harshad numbers as the numbers n with the property that n/s(n), where s(n) is the sum of the digits of n, is integer (see the sequence A005349). In this paper I define the notion of Harshad-Coman numbers as the numbers n with the property that (n – 1)/(s(n) – 1), where s(n) is the sum of the digits of n, is integer and I make the conjecture that there exist an infinity of Poulet numbers which are also Harshad-Coman numbers.

The Collatz conjecture is an open conjecture in mathematics named so after Lothar Collatz who proposed it in 1937. It is also known as 3n + 1 conjecture, the Ulam conjecture (after Stanislaw Ulam), Kakutanis problem (after Shizuo
Kakutani) and so on. Several various generalization of the Collatz conjecture
has been carried. In this paper a new generalization of the Collatz conjecture
called as the 3n ± p conjecture; where p is a prime is proposed. It functions on
3n + p and 3n - p, and for any starting number n, its sequence eventually enters
a finite cycle and there are finitely many such cycles. The 3n ± 1 conjecture, is
a special case of the 3n ± p conjecture when p is 1.
